Oamaru Waterworks General Plan of Inlet works. Sheet number 1 [Black Point Section]. Oamaru Waterworks General Plan of Inlet works. Sheet number 1 [Black Point Section].
McLeod, Donald A
Circa 1877
Oamaru Waterworks General Plan of Inlet works. Sheet no.1. (Black Point Section). Plan showing inlet, conduit from Waitaki River, pond, weir, sluices, conduit to Oamaru, willow planting, etc. Coloured. Official Copy. Donald McLeod, Engineer.

House in a Summer Garden House in a Summer Garden
Stoddart, Margaret Olrog (b.1865, d.1934)
1928
Typifying Margaret Stoddart's garden works, House in a Summer Garden is either of a hill property near Margaret’s own home at 15 Hackthorne Road, Cashmere, where she lived from 1912, or on Clifton Hill where she often painted in the 1920s.

Like many of her garden paintings it is colourful. The mass of colour is built up in vigorous broad strokes over an underlying structure of wet washes, dissolving one into the other. The house is almost buried behind a cascade of brilliantly coloured blooms. The garden subject provided Stoddart with not only the opportunity to explore the growth of introduced domestic plants which contrasted strongly with native flora, but also to vent her robust colour sense.
